BULLETPROOF COFFEE
1 cup brewed coffee
1 T. butter
1 T. coconut oil
1/4 tsp real vanilla extract and/or cinnamon
1 tsp. Swerve or Monkfruit sweetener

Put all ingredients in a blender for 10-20 seconds. If you want the coffee to stay hotter, you can melt the butter and oil together first. I also recently bought a bottle of Torani Sugar-Free Vanilla Bean syrup on Amazon, and use that now instead of the sweetener/flavour.

LOADED CHAI
I cup brewed chai tea (any brand)
1/4 cup Better Half (coconut and almond coffee creamer)
1 T coconut oil
1 tsp Swerve or Monkfruit

Blend in a blender.

KEY LIME FAT BOMBS
3 tbsp erythritol swerve
2 tbsp lime juice
1 tbsp lime zest finely grated
6 oz cream cheese
4 tbsp butter

1/2 cup Coconut Flakes ( Optional) to roll the finished fat bombs in.

Instructions
In a mixing bowl combine lime juice, lime zest, and erythritol.
Soften the cream cheese and butter.
Add softened cheese and butter to the bowl with the lime juice mixture.
Mix thoroughly
Put the mixture in the fridge for a few minutes so it firms up, and make 8 even balls, roll in coconut flakes if desired and put them on parchment covered pan and freeze. (the nutrition info is for 8 servings, but you can make them bigger or smaller)
Keep them in the freezer until they are solid.
Take them out and Enjoy. (about 2 Hours)
You can store these in the freezer or fridge.
Notes
If you buy two small limes, you will get enough juice and zest for this recipe. To soften cream cheese and butter put it in toaster oven at about 150ยบ F for a couple minutes. or , you can put it in the microwave for 10-15 seconds.
